How do I apply for VA pension benefits?

You can apply for Veterans Pension online or download and complete VA Form 21P-527EZ, “Application for Pension”. You can mail your application to the Pension Management Center (PMC) that serves your state. You may also visit your local regional benefit office and turn in your application for processing.

Can veterans get pension and compensation?

You cannot receive a VA non-service connected pension and service-connected disability compensation at the same time. However, if you apply for a pension benefit and are awarded payments, VA will pay you whichever benefit is greater.

What is the difference between veterans compensation and pension?

Income: VA Pension benefits are given only to veterans who can demonstrate financial need. Standard VA Disability Compensation does not take into account income when awarding benefits. Compensation rates are based on level of disability, whereas pension rates are based on income level.

What documents are needed to apply for VA benefits?

To fill out this application, you’ll need your:

  • Social Security number (required)
  • Copy of your military discharge papers (DD214 or other separation documents)
  • Financial information—and your dependents’ financial information.
  • Most recent tax return.

Who gets a VA pension?

To receive Pension, a veteran must have served on active duty at least 90 days, during a period of war. There must an honorable discharge or other qualifying discharge. Single surviving spouses of such veterans are also eligible.

Is a VA pension and VA disability compensation the same thing?

VA compensation and a VA pension are not the same thing. … VA pension is a benefit paid on the basis of a disability that was not a result of active service in the military, or because of age. Pension is also based on income. There are other criteria that may apply to deciding eligibility for VA pension.8 мая 2006 г.

What is the VA special monthly compensation?

VA special monthly compensation (SMC) is a higher rate of compensation that we pay to Veterans as well as their spouses, surviving spouses, and parents with certain needs or disabilities.

Can military retiree collect VA disability?

Concurrent Retirement and Disability Pay (CRDP) allows military retirees to receive both military retired pay and Veterans Affairs (VA) compensation. … This means that an eligible retiree’s retired pay will gradually increase each year until the phase in is complete effective January 2014.

Can you receive VA disability and unemployment at the same time?

Disability compensation payments from the VA do not reduce your unemployment check. You can receive your full unemployment compensation along with your full disability payment from the VA.

What happens to my VA disability when I die?

No, a veteran’s disability compensation payments are not continued for a surviving spouse after death. However, survivors may be entitled to a different type of benefit called Dependency and Indemnity Compensation.9 мая 2017 г.

Does the widow of a veteran get benefits?

Survivors of veterans who served during wartime can apply to receive a tax-free pension, known as a Survivors Pension or Death Pension. The pension provides a monthly payment to surviving spouses with modest incomes who have not remarried.
